Buying Guide: Key Considerations For Tile Cutting Blades
- Material compatibility: Check if the blade is rated for porcelain, ceramic, granite, marble, or glass, and ensure it matches your tile type.
- Blade thickness and design: Ultra-thin blades offer cleaner cuts with less chipping but may require careful handling to avoid breakage; thicker cores can reduce vibration and improve stability.
- Cutting method: Decide between wet cutting, dry cutting, or both. Wet cutting cools the blade and reduces dust and heat, while dry cutting is convenient where water access is limited.
- Arbor size and compatibility: Confirm the blade’s arbor size (e.g., 7/8″ or 5/8″) and any bushings needed to fit your angle grinder.
- Durability and life: Look for a robust core, high-quality diamond particles, and a design that minimizes wobble to extend blade life and improve cut quality.
- Safety and performance: Features such as reduced vibration, spark-free operation in some blades, and chip-free cutting contribute to safer, more controlled cuts.
- Cost versus value: A multi-blade pack can offer better value for projects requiring repetitive cuts, while premium blades may be worth it for high-precision work on tough materials.
- Maintenance: Clean blades after use, inspect for edge wear, and store properly to preserve diamond coating and cutting efficiency.
